Filling stations shut as depots battle fuel shortage

Nigerians are still struggling to get Premium Motor Spirit, popularly known as petrol, as depots continue to battle fuel shortage. Checks by our correspondent showed that many filling stations in Lagos, Abuja, Ogun, and other states are still shut down due to their inability to access PMS. 27 states, FCT yet to set up minimum wage panels

Twenty-seven states and the Federal Capital Territory have yet to set up committees to implement the recently approved N70,000 minimum wage. The states are Plateau, Kebbi, Sokoto, Nasarawa, Bayelsa, Delta, Osun, Ekiti, Zamfara, Benue, Enugu, Taraba, Gombe, Kogi, Enugu, Adamawa, Niger, Anambra, Imo, Ebonyi, Oyo, Akwa Ibom, Bauchi, Katsina, Kaduna, Cross River and Yobe. Cultists kill Ogun community leader’s son, one other

Some suspected cultists on Friday night reportedly killed a 48-year-old Point-of-Sale operator, Fatai Kehinde, under Kuto bridge, Abeokuta. The PoS operator popularly called Faity and son of the Baale of Kuto Community, Abeokuta, was said to have been butchered by his assailants who chased him from his shop inside Kuto market to Kuto under bridge. Police nab Ogun kidnappers, discover victims’ shallow graves

The Ogun State Police Command said that it had discovered the shallow graves of 71-year-old farmer Adekunle Ifelaja and Ogunyemi Femi, who were allegedly killed by suspected kidnappers in the Ijebu-Igbo area of Ogun State.
